Inspired by Yasunari Kawabata’s novel The House of the Sleeping Beauties, The Bathhouse of Honest Desires is a Japanese-Taiwanese co-production written and directed by two internationally renowned playwrights and directors. This work by Kuro Tanino, the director of NIWA GEKIDAN PENINO, and Chia-Ming Wang, the director of Shakespeare’s Wild Sister Group in Taiwan, first premiered at Taiwan’s National Theater and Concert Hall in 2024. Across countless discussions, the two artists put many hours into completing this narrative.

“Once upon a time, in a small island country, there was a bathhouse with no name.” Beginning with this narration, the play is performed by Japanese and Taiwanese actors who each speak in their own languages. A former psychiatrist, Tanino is an artist whose distinct narrative world is akin to a beautiful nightmare upon which the subconscious desires of humans are projected. Wang specializes in remixing visual and sound effects and masterfully reconstructs stories through his direction. A unique cast of Japanese and Taiwanese performers will deliver a fairy tale for adults, the fruits of the two artists’ experimental collaboration.
